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send a team of experts to ass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your property back to normal.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to identify the source of the flood and develop a strategy to extract the water.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our crew will use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your property.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to reduce the amount of time your home is out of commission.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your property is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ining water and debris. We’ll also use specialized equipment to detect and remove any hidden moisture.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Follow-up
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and dry. We’ll also follow up with you to ensure you’re satisfied with our service and to answer any questions you may have.

Flood Water Extraction Cost in Barre, MA
The cost of flood water extraction in Barre, MA, var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and transparent, and we’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water present.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ry and dehumidify.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of cleaning and sanitizing required. |
| Final Inspection and Follow-up |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job. |

What’s the difference between flood water extraction and flood damage restoration?
Flood water extraction focuses on removing standing water from your property, while flood damage restoration involves repairing and replacing damaged areas. Our team can handle both services to get your property back to normal.
